Umarov's temporary resignation as "Imarat Kavkaz" leader could be caused by health problems

The last week's information of separatists about Dokku Umarov's voluntary resignation from the post of Amir of the "Imarat Kavkaz", founded by him in 2007, and the same unexpected statement about his return to the post are actively discussed in Chechnya.

Some experts believe that both events had a rather long time gap, and Umarov's state of health could be the reason of his self-resignation.

"When Umarov declared his resignation, only two persons were close to him - Aslambek Vadalov, named by Umarov to be the new 'Amir', and the Arabian field commander Mukhannad. Then, the 'Amir of Kavkaz' himself looked seriously sick and a bit inadequate. But in the video, where he refuted his former statement, Umarov looked and spoke much better. It can't be of course excluded that both his resignation and return to the post were caused by the pressure of his companions, but his health problems also played not the last role here," the head of one of Chechens NGOs believes.

Another local observer has noted that the videos with participation of Umarov were made at various times. "In the first report, where Umarov announced his intention to retire, we see faded grass and absence of greenery. That is, most likely, the video was made in early spring. It was then, under available data, that Dokku Umarov was poisoned and had serious health problems. I don't exclude that then Umarov was really afraid of his possible death; therefore, he announced his resignation and Aslambek Vadalov as his successor," he believes.

"The second record already shows some greenery, which is an indirect indication that Umarov made the second statement more recently," the expert has emphasized and expressed his opinion that the tactics and strategy of the armed underground would not essentially change in the near future, since Umarov remains the leader of North-Caucasian militants.
